Impact of the use of botulinium toxin type A in the current treatment off chronic migraine in adults

Abstract: Introduction: Migraine is a complex neurological disorder that causes recurrent, localized headaches and is associated with hyperstimulation of the muscles in the frontal, temporal, occipital, and trapezius regions. Botulinum toxin acts on the motor plate by blocking the action of acetylcholine, thereby producing an analgesic effect in these patients. Materials and methods: A systematic review will be conducted using the PubMed and Scielo electronic databases. The search criteria were studies and reviews published between 2014 and April 2020 to identify transitional research focused on the use of botulinum toxin in patients with chronic migraine. Results: Nine articles that met the criteria for evaluating the efficacy of chronic migraine treatment using Onabotulimumtoxin A were included. An average of three cycles of the PREEMPT treatment protocol were performed. The mean age was 47 years, and 82.5% were women. The frequency of headache days/month and its intensity were significantly reduced by 30 to 50%, and this improvement was maintained over time. Conclusion: Randomized studies have shown that long-term, fixed-dose, fixed-site intramuscular injection therapy with botulinum toxin A is a safe and effective procedure with insignificant complications in appropriately selected patients.
